Arroll, Dr Meg: Tiny Traumas

When you don't know what's wrong, but nothing feels quite right
When little things have big impacts. This book is for anyone who feels that they're sleepwalking through life, looking for answers to challenging emotions and the practical tools to begin living the life they want.

Über den Autor Arroll, Dr Meg

Dr Meg Arroll (PhD, CPsychol, CSci, AFBPsS, FHEA, MISCPAccred) is a chartered psychologist, scientist and author specialising in health and wellbeing. Dr Meg's solution-focused approach gives practical tips and strategies for life's tricky problems, that are both complex and everyday. Dr Meg is a regular contributor to national newspapers and magazines such as The Daily Mail, Metro, Psychologies and Women's Own, Top Sante and Stylist, and features regularly on radio programmes and podcasts.
